1983 Fiat Ritmo vs. 1971 Simca 1301
To start off, 1983 Fiat Ritmo is newer by 12 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1971 Simca 1301.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1971 Simca 1301 would be higher. At 1,714 cc (4 cylinders), 1983 Fiat Ritmo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1983 Fiat Ritmo (57 HP @ 4500 RPM) has 6 more horse power than 1971 Simca 1301. (51 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1983 Fiat Ritmo should accelerate faster than 1971 Simca 1301.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1971 Simca 1301 weights approximately 120 kg more than 1983 Fiat Ritmo.
Let's talk about torque, 1983 Fiat Ritmo (105 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 5 more torque (in Nm) than 1971 Simca 1301. (100 Nm @ 2400 RPM). This means 1983 Fiat Ritmo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1971 Simca 1301.
Compare all specifications:
1983 Fiat Ritmo | 1971 Simca 1301 | |
Make | Fiat | Simca |
Model | Ritmo | 1301 |
Year Released | 1983 | 1971 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1714 cc | 1290 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 57 HP | 51 HP |
Engine RPM | 4500 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 105 Nm | 100 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82.6 mm | 74 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 79.2 mm | 75 mm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Vehicle Weight | 920 kg | 1040 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4020 mm | 4330 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1660 mm | 1590 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1410 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2460 mm | 2530 mm |
